Quick Summary

When to Choose Brazil Nuts

Choose Brazil Nuts for more fiber (7.5g vs 4g) and more healthy fats (68g vs 48g) per 100g.

When to Choose Hemp Hearts

Choose Hemp Hearts for more protein (32g vs 15g) and more magnesium (700mg vs 382mg) per 100g. It is also lower in calories (553 vs 668 per 100g).

Health Benefits Comparison

Brazil Nuts Benefits

  • Highest selenium content of any food (777% DV per oz)
  • Just 2 nuts provide 100% daily selenium needs
  • Rich in healthy fats for heart health
  • Provides magnesium (26% DV) for muscle function
  • Good copper source (24% DV) for iron absorption

Hemp Hearts Benefits

  • Complete protein with all 9 essential amino acids and 9.5g protein per 30g serving
  • Ideal 3:1 omega-6 to omega-3 ratio supports cardiovascular and brain health
  • Rich in GLA (gamma-linolenic acid) which reduces inflammation and supports hormones
  • High in magnesium (210mg per 100g) for energy production and muscle function
